Why Your Car Needs This — Especially in Ewa Beach


Ewa Beach and the leeward side of Oahu present some of the toughest conditions for your exterior.


Each factor on its own is hard enough.


Together, they speed up wear and tear if you do not stay ahead of them.


Here is what your car is facing every day:


  • Strong sun and high UV degrade clear coat, fade trim, and haze plastics faster on the leeward side.
    The darker and more saturated your paint, the quicker UV makes flaws stand out.
    Headlights, mirror caps, and unprotected plastics can lose their clarity if they are not refreshed and protected on a regular basis.
  • Sea breezes carry salt aerosols inland; salt attracts moisture and speeds corrosion on paint, wheels, and hardware.
    Even if you never park right on the sand, those salt particles still settle on horizontal surfaces.
    Over time, they hide in seams, along window edges, and behind emblems, quietly starting the corrosion process.
  • Ewa Plain’s iron‑oxide “red dirt” sticks and stains if it is not lifted safely.
    That dust can build up in wheel wells, on lower rocker panels, and around bumpers, leaving a dull film and potential staining.
    If it is scrubbed the wrong way, it can also behave like a fine abrasive against your clear coat.
  • Drive‑through washes miss jambs, wells, emblems, and engine plastics — and can add swirls.
    Those spinning brushes and harsh chemicals are built for speed, not care.
    They frequently leave behind shadowy dirt in tight areas while adding new wash marks to the paint itself.

Here’s the Exact Process (Step by Step)

Every exterior visit follows a clear, repeatable series of steps so nothing important is skipped.

You know what is happening to your vehicle at each stage, from the first rinse to the final wipe.


1. High‑pressure pre‑rinse

A controlled rinse knocks off loose grit, salt film, and red‑dirt dust so you do not grind abrasives into your clear coat.


This first pass is all about removing as much loose contamination as possible before any mitt ever touches the paint.


By rinsing thoughtfully around seams, wheels, and lower panels, the risk of swirling and micro‑marring is reduced right from the start.


2. Thick snow‑foam pre‑soak

A pH‑balanced foam cannon blankets the vehicle to encapsulate grime, soften bug residue, and begin lifting bonded dirt in seams and badges.


The foam clings to vertical and horizontal surfaces, giving the cleaners time to work so dirt is loosened before the hand wash.


This step helps reduce friction and makes the actual contact wash safer for your finish.


3. Hand wash with scratch control

A microfiber wash mitt and dual‑bucket, grit‑guard method reduce swirl marks and micro‑marring while gently cleaning panels, glass, and trim.


One bucket holds your clean solution, and the other traps dirt at the bottom so the mitt is rinsed thoroughly between passes.


This approach protects clear coat and modern paints from the fine scratches that build up over time with rushed wash techniques.


4. Tight‑area degrease and clean

Door jambs, sills, fuel door, emblems, and wheel wells get targeted degreasing to remove oily film, red‑dirt staining, and road tar that regular washes miss.


These are the places most automated washes ignore, yet they are the exact areas you see and touch when you open doors or walk behind the car.


By cleaning them on purpose, the whole vehicle feels more honestly detailed, not just the easy surfaces.


5. Wheel and brake‑dust decontamination

Soft‑bristle wheel tools and finish‑safe wheel cleaner break down baked‑on brake dust and road film on barrels, faces, and lug areas to restore a crisp, even finish.


Wheels that once looked flat gray or brown shift back toward the color and sheen they had when they were new.


This also makes future cleaning easier, since less buildup is sitting on the surface.


6. Engine bay clean and dress

Plastics and painted surfaces under the hood are safely degreased, lightly rinsed, and dressed to an even, factory‑fresh look while sensitive electrical areas are handled with care.


An engine bay that looked tired and dusty can return to a clean, organized appearance that matches the rest of the detail.


This step is done carefully and intentionally so you can open the hood without being greeted by years of built‑up grime.


7. Tire clean and dress

Tires are scrubbed to remove browning and then dressed to a clean, satin, non‑sling finish that complements the paint without looking greasy.


A proper tire clean brightens the entire side profile of the vehicle.


The satin look avoids the wet, sticky shine that flings onto paint and attracts dust.


8. Protective wax layer

A uniform wax or sealant layer is applied to boost gloss, add hydrophobic protection, and help resist UV, salt spray, and daily grime so your next wash is faster.


As water begins to bead and sheet more easily, you will notice that rinsing and drying take less effort.

This layer is your first line of defense between the environment and your clear coat.


9. Trim restoration and protection

Exterior plastics receive a UV‑protective dressing to restore color and slow future fading in Ewa’s high‑sun conditions.


Faded trim often makes a vehicle look older than it is, even when the paint still has life.

With the right dressing, those plastics gain a richer tone and better protection from future sun exposure.


10. Crystal‑clear glass

Exterior glass and mirrors are polished with a streak‑free foaming cleaner for maximum clarity and safer night driving.


Clear glass changes how you experience the road, especially with oncoming headlights or rain.

This final step pulls the whole exterior together so every angle looks finished.

Why This Process Is Safe for Your Paint


Your wash uses pH‑balanced shampoos and targeted cleaners to protect clear coat and modern finishes while removing the grime that builds up faster in Ewa’s sun and sea air.


The chemistry is chosen to loosen and lift contaminants rather than strip or burn the surface.


Microfiber mitts and grit‑guard buckets keep abrasives away from the paint, which reduces the swirls that cheaper brushes cause.


By constantly rinsing and isolating dirt, the team makes each pass over the paint as gentle as possible while still effective.


Wheel tools are finish‑safe, so painted, machined, or coated wheels keep their integrity as baked brake dust is dissolved and lifted.


Instead of blasting harsh chemicals at your rims, the process combines smart products and careful tools built to respect the finish.


Tire and trim dressings are chosen for a clean, satin look that resists sling and UV chalking, rather than a greasy shine that attracts dust.


This keeps the focus on a balanced, refined appearance rather than a temporary, overly wet look.


Specialty decontaminants are applied only where needed and then fully neutralized and rinsed, so your finish looks better now and stays healthier over time.


Every step is designed to protect your clear coat, plastics, and wheels while still dealing with the realities of Oahu’s environment.


Ewa Beach Realities This Service Is Built For


This exterior detail exists because Ewa Beach and the surrounding areas are uniquely hard on vehicles.

The process acknowledges those realities and works with them instead of pretending they do not exist.


  • Leeward dryness and strong sun: higher UV peaks most of the year mean clear coat and plastics need regular protection and top‑ups.
    Long, bright days can quickly fade unprotected surfaces, especially on darker vehicles and exposed trim.
  • Trade winds and daily sea breezes: salt aerosols drift inland toward the Ewa‑Waianae coast, accelerating corrosion on exposed metal and hardware.
    Even a car that never leaves town can slowly collect salt residue that works its way into seams and crevices over time.
  • Red‑dirt dust on the Ewa Plain: iron‑oxide soils stain and cling; safe chemistry and gentle mechanics matter to lift it without etching.
    Lower panels, wheels, and wheel wells are especially vulnerable if they are not cleaned and protected on a consistent schedule.
  • Oahu storms and winter fronts: oily road film and mineral deposits build quickly; timely decon and protection keep maintenance easy.

When conditions swing from dry and dusty to wet and messy, your exterior can pick up a mix of contaminants in a short period.
